Working under the supervision of a physician or registered nurse (RN), a licensed vocational nurse (LVN) provides basic bedside care to sick, elderly, convalescent, disabled or injured patients. In every state except Texas and California, an LVN is called a licensed practical nurse (LPN), but the job description is identical.

Vocational Nurses are an important part of the medical field. These nurses are trained to complete practical procedures, caring for and monitoring patients’ health. Vocational Nurses are used in nursing homes, hospitals, schools and home care agencies.
